Output 51619cb39bc65d09af504d32a810630df95089654b27b5ba0e33d2a652ef9687:63

value
1628700
script pubkey
OP_0 OP_PUSHBYTES_20 2e64892235c71eb2ffe69e37c8d51cc69c1995fa
address
bc1q9ejgjg34cu0t9llxncmu34guc6wpn906007ppl
transaction
51619cb39bc65d09af504d32a810630df95089654b27b5ba0e33d2a652ef9687
spent
true